In this beginner\u2019s guide, we\u2019ll show you how to do just that using either a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/introducing-salesforce-cms\/\">content management system (CMS)<\/a> or a website builder, as well as cover the basics so you can get started.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-quick-recap-what-is-website-development\">Quick recap: <strong>What is website development?<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Website development refers to the process of planning, building, designing, and maintaining a website for your business. The website development process is split into two main sections: <strong>front-end and back-end.<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-back-end-development-web-development\"><strong>Back-end development (web development)<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The back end is the server-side part of your website that your customers don\u2019t see. It\u2019s all about how the site functions, how fast your pages load, and how easy your site is to use.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Backend web developers need to learn coding and generally how to make sure everything runs smoothly. This means being familiar with server-side languages like <a href=\"https:\/\/www.python.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Python<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-front-end-development-web-design\"><strong>Front-end development (web design)<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The front end is the customer-facing part of your website. This encompasses the visual elements that help your customer navigate your pages, as well as the graphics, layouts, navigation, and content. It often involves using programming languages like JavaScript to create seamless menus that help users navigate through your pages.&nbsp;May seem complicated, but it&#8217;s just a language to learn.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Front-end web developers have a lot in common with graphic designers. They spend a lot of time picking the perfect colour palettes, deciding on the best graphics and selecting legible fonts. They may also need to consider the words included on a page.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-salesforce-blog-multi-offer\">\n\t<div>\n\t\t\n\n<div class=\"alignfull alt=\"\">\n\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-how-to-create-a-website-for-your-growing-business\"><strong>How to create a website<\/strong> for your growing business<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>If this is your first time building a website, we strongly recommend you opt for a CMS or website builder to streamline the process. Here\u2019s how to get started: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-step-1-plan-your-project\"><strong>Step 1: Plan your project<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Before you pick a theme or write any code, you\u2019ll need to define your project and understand what you want to achieve. Here\u2019s what to do.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-define-the-basics\"><strong>Define the basics<\/strong><\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>First, work out all of the basic elements: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Business essentials: <\/strong>Define what you offer, your unique value proposition, your mission, and your values.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Stakeholders: <\/strong>Determine which key stakeholders will need to be involved in the web design process.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Competition: <\/strong>Take the time to understand your competitors. These will be a valuable source of information, but you also need to understand how you can set yourself apart from the crowd.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-understand-your-target-audience\"><strong>Understand your target audience<\/strong><\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>You need to understand your audience before you begin designing your website. Start gathering information and create an <a href=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/buyer-persona\/\">ideal buyer persona<\/a> to build an understanding of your perfect customer. You can carry out surveys to gather insights directly, or explore your competition to identify opportunities.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>This knowledge will lay the foundation for everything from your website layout and graphics to font and colour scheme. The more details you know at this stage, the better.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-identify-your-goals\"><strong>Identify your goals<\/strong><\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>Once you understand your audience and competition, define some goals that will underpin your development process. Here are some common objectives and what you\u2019ll need to prioritise to achieve them.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Generating leads:<\/strong> Create valuable content that people can download in exchange for email addresses or inquiries.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Growing organic traffic: <\/strong>Prioritise search engine optimisation (SEO) strategies to help visitors find your website online.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Improving product sales:<\/strong> Create enticing product pages and a seamless eCommerce website checkout process.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Improving brand image: <\/strong>Design a visually appealing website with first-class customer service options like live chat and FAQs.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-conduct-keyword-research\"><strong>Conduct keyword research<\/strong><\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/seo-for-startups\/\">Search engine optimisation (SEO)<\/a> will help you improve your website\u2019s position in the search results, helping more people find you online. You should spend some time in this preliminary stage researching keywords that you can target within your content.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Using keyword research tools like <a href=\"https:\/\/www.semrush.com\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Semrush<\/a>, and Google Keyword Planner, research your competitors to learn the words and phrases they\u2019re ranking for. You can use this to create a list that you can refer back to when you begin writing content for your pages.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-consider-the-website-elements-to-include\"><strong>Consider the website elements to include<\/strong><\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>Lastly, you should think about the elements your site will feature based on your goals, competitor research and understanding of your audience. Common sections include: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Homepage<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>About Us<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Contact <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Blog <\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Product pages<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>FAQs<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Case studies<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Once you\u2019ve decided on your ideal pages, your planning is complete. You should now have everything in place to begin building your site.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-step-2-choose-your-website-domain-name\"><strong>Step 2: Choose your website domain name<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>First, in the web development process, you need to think about your domain name. This is the URL that your customers will associate with your website. A great choice can communicate your professionalism and even help with your SEO efforts. Here are some tips.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Make it memorable:<\/strong> Don\u2019t make your domain name too long. Two to four words are best. Also, try to make it catchy so it rolls off the tongue.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Stick to words:<\/strong> Don&#8217;t include numbers or hyphens in your domain name, as these can make it harder for people to remember and type into a search bar.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Make it relevant:<\/strong> Choose a domain name that aligns with your brand. It needs to resemble your brand\u2019s core messaging and values closely.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Think about SEO:<\/strong> Is there a keyword or meaning that you can include in your domain to boost your SEO efforts? While optional, this can help more customers find you online.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Got a few ideas in mind? <\/strong>Run them through a domain name checker to see if your choices are available. In addition, decide on an extension that aligns with your website. Using .com is the most popular choice, but you could also opt for .net, .store, .blog, or .org, depending on your brand.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Once that&#8217;s complete, you can register your domain with your chosen hosting provider and secure an SSL certificate. It all starts with Starter Suite.<\/p>\n\t\t\t\n\t\t\t\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"wp-block-button\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<a class=\"wp-block-button__link\" target=\"_blank\" href=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/form\/signup\/freetrial-salesforce-starter\/?d=bcta\">Try for free<\/a>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\n\t\t<div class=\"wp-block-offer__media\">\n\t\t\t<img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"577\" src=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2025\/12\/Salesforce-free-suite.png\" class=\"attachment-full size-full\" alt=\"\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2025\/12\/Salesforce-free-suite.png 1268w, https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2025\/12\/Salesforce-free-suite.png?w=300&amp;h=169 300w, https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2025\/12\/Salesforce-free-suite.png?w=768&amp;h=432 768w, https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2025\/12\/Salesforce-free-suite.png?w=1024&amp;h=577 1024w, https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2025\/12\/Salesforce-free-suite.png?w=150&amp;h=84 150w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/>\t\t<\/div>\n\t<\/div>\n\n\t\n\t<\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-step-4-build-your-site-structure\"><strong>Step 4: Build your site structure<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>A site map will help your users navigate around your website. It ensures every customer can get exactly where they need to go without frustration.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Naturally, you\u2019ll want to start with a homepage. Then, think about the different landing pages for your business website that you\u2019d like your users to click on. A common navigation bar at the top of a homepage.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>From there, spend some time refining and optimising your navigation.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-optimise-your-website-flow\"><strong>Optimise your website flow<\/strong><\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>Here are some tips to make it easy for your visitors to navigate your site.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Dropdowns: <\/strong>Use dropdown lists to ensure your pages are manageable. For instance, a \u2018Meet the Team\u2019 page could easily fit underneath the \u2018About Us\u2019 section. Your portfolio and customer testimonials could both fall under \u2018Why Choose Us.\u2019 If your site is too confusing to navigate, you\u2019ll end up with a high bounce rate.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Menu placement: <\/strong>Keep your navigation menus in the same place on every page so your users can navigate easily. A sticky menu is one of the easiest ways to achieve this.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Add a search function: <\/strong>Place a search bar to the top of your page so your visitors can search for what they\u2019re looking for. This is a great choice if you have an extensive product list or content catalogue.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Breadcrumbs: <\/strong>Add breadcrumbs (trails of links) to show users the hierarchy of the page they\u2019re currently on. This allows customers to \u2018backtrack\u2019 to higher-level pages, aiding navigation and creating a better user experience.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>At all times, think about how you can make your website provide users with the best possible experience. The more you know your audience, the easier it is to get in their shoes and figure out what they need from you and how you can provide it.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-step-5-design-your-website\"><strong>Step 5: Design your website<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The <a href=\"https:\/\/help.salesforce.com\/s\/articleView?id=platform.build_your_site.htm&amp;language=en_US&amp;type=5\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">design<\/a> and development process will differ depending on your chosen platform. However, there are some essential considerations you should think about regardless of your chosen solution.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Template: <\/strong>Choose a template in your chosen CMS or website builder that aligns with your sitemap, brand identity and style. Double-check the template works well on mobile.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Colour schemes: <\/strong>What colours will you use to convey your brand\u2019s tone, voice, and messaging? Research colour theory and psychology to find a palette that aligns with your business ideas and audience.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Typography: <\/strong>Choose an interesting, engaging font that is easy to read.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Layout:<\/strong> How do you want each of your pages to look? Come up with a rudimentary design before you start building your pages in your chosen tool.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Through all of this, consider how your website will appear on mobiles.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.statista.com\/statistics\/277125\/share-of-website-traffic-coming-from-mobile-devices\/#:~:text=Mobile%20accounts%20for%20approximately%20half,before%20surpassing%20it%20in%202020.\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Mobile accounts for over 53%<\/a> of traffic worldwide, so you need to keep this in mind as you choose your design elements.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-key-features-for-your-business-website\"><strong>Key features for your business website<\/strong><\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>While the web design process is unique to your business, you should consider implementing some of these core features: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Call to action (CTA): <\/strong>Include <a href=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/what-is-a-call-to-action\/\">CTAs<\/a> on every page. Depending on your business goals, this could be to get in touch, fill out a form, or download a piece of content. Either way, make sure it\u2019s easy to find.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Titles: <\/strong>Your headers should be easy to read and descriptive. They can be creative but don\u2019t make them ambiguous. For a technical tip, make sure your headers are above the fold so your users can see them even when scrolling down the page.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Contact information:<\/strong> What use is a website if your customers are unable to contact you? Include a contact form with all of your details so prospects can reach out to you.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Payment gateway: <\/strong>How will your audience pay for your products or services?&nbsp;Choose a payment processing provider that can accept different forms of payment. Then, consider how you\u2019ll integrate this feature into your web pages.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Social media integration:<\/strong> Consider incorporating <a href=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/blog\/best-social-media-platforms-for-small-business\/\">social media platforms<\/a> into your website. Live social feeds, user-generated content, social media icon buttons, and even follow and share buttons on blog content are all exceptional ways to link your Facebook, Instagram and TikTok directly to your page. This can drive traffic on both sides of the equation.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-step-6-create-content-for-your-pages\"><strong>Step 6: Create content for your pages<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>High-quality content creation is vital for attracting customers. It will help you to engage your audience, convey your brand messaging, and guide your customers down your <a href=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/sales\/funnel\/\">sales funnel<\/a>.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Your landing page content is the best place to start. What are the core messages you want to convey to your audience? You can look at your competitors for inspiration, but here are some additional tips: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Keep it concise: <\/strong>You don\u2019t want to overwhelm your prospective customers, so keep your text short and sweet.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Use headers and subheaders:<\/strong> Break up long pieces of text with headings to boost readability.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Incorporate images and videos:<\/strong> Use videos and imagery to improve your site\u2019s aesthetics while communicating core messaging faster. Just remember to optimise this media so it doesn\u2019t ruin your site\u2019s loading times.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>As an aside, consider creating a handful of blogs. While blogging will be an ongoing part of your website journey, you\u2019ll appreciate having some engaging content ready to upload when your site goes live.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-optimise-your-content-for-seo\"><strong>Optimise your content for SEO<\/strong><\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>As we touched on earlier, SEO is one of the best ways to make sure your audience can find you online. We won\u2019t get into the finer details of SEO in this guide, but here are a few best practices you need to know: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Keywords: <\/strong>Conduct keyword research to identify the words and phrases your audience is using in search engines like Google. Then, incorporate these keywords naturally into your content.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Meta tags:<\/strong> Write meta titles and meta descriptions that accurately describe the contents of each page.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Images: <\/strong>Compress images to ensure your website loads quickly. <a href=\"https:\/\/pagespeed.web.dev\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Google PageSpeed Insights<\/a> can help you find ways to improve.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Responsiveness: <\/strong>Make sure your website is optimised for every device. Test it on all devices, including tablets and mobiles.&nbsp;<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Internal linking: <\/strong>Link to other areas of your site within each page\u2019s content. This helps Google to understand the structure of your website.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>SEO is a powerful tool that you can continuously improve over time. Activate&nbsp;<a href=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/crm\/foundations\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Foundations<\/a>&nbsp;to try out&nbsp;<a href=\"https:\/\/www.salesforce.com\/ap\/platform\/agentforce-platform\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Agentforce 360<\/a>&nbsp;today.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><em>AI supported the writers and editors who created this article.<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-frequently-asked-questions-faqs\"><strong>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n<div class=\"accordion \">\n\t\n\n<button class=\"accordion-header\" type=\"button\">Do I need to learn to code to build a website?<\/button>\n<div class=\"accordion-content\">\n\t\n\n<p>No, not necessarily. While traditional web development requires coding knowledge (like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ript), beginners can easily build functional and attractive websites using Content Management Systems (CMS) like Salesforce CMS.<\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<button class=\"accordion-header\" type=\"button\">What is the difference between a CMS and a website builder?<\/button>\n<div class=\"accordion-content\">\n\t\n\n<p>A Content Management System (CMS), like WordPress or Salesforce CMS, offers greater flexibility and customisation, often allowing access to the back-end code for experienced developers, but typically requires you to arrange your own web hosting.<\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<button class=\"accordion-header\" type=\"button\">How much does it cost to develop a website?<\/button>\n<div class=\"accordion-content\">\n\t\n\n<p>The cost varies widely. You can start a basic site for free or very low cost using freemium website builders. However, a professional website for a small business will typically involve costs between $5 &#8211; $150 per month. <\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<button class=\"accordion-header\" type=\"button\">What is SEO and why is it important for my new website?<\/button>\n<div class=\"accordion-content\">\n\t\n\n<p>SEO stands for Search Engine Optimisation. It is the process of optimising your website to rank higher in search engine results (like Google) for relevant keywords. It is important because it helps potential customers find your business online when they are searching for products or services you offer.<\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<button class=\"accordion-header\" type=\"button\">How long does it take to develop a website?<\/button>\n<div class=\"accordion-content\">\n\t\n\n<p>The timeline depends entirely on the complexity of the site and the method you choose. A very simple site using a website builder might be ready in a day or two. A small business website using a CMS might take 2-4 weeks for planning, design, content creation, and testing. A large, highly customised, or ecommerce site could take several months.<\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n\n<\/div> <!-- \/.accordion -->\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Discover how to create a website with our easy, step-by-step guide.
